Illegal Alien from Honduras Arrested in New York After Evading Prison Sentence

A fugitive on the Honduran "Top 10 Most Wanted" list, Olivin Martinez Coto, has been arrested in New York after managing to evade a lengthy prison sentence back in his home country. The U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) confirmed that Coto was apprehended on Long Island, where he had reportedly been hiding from the authorities.

Coto was sentenced in Honduras for serious offenses, including aggravated femicide, which refers to the act of killing a woman because of her gender. Alongside this conviction, he faced charges of attempted homicide and home invasion. ICE pointed out that he had been deported from the United States twice before, indicating a long-standing disregard for U.S. immigration laws.

ICE also stated that they are uncertain about how Coto re-entered the U.S. for a third time, only noting that it occurred after his last deportation in February 2019. The agency confirmed their unyielding efforts to pursue and expel international fugitives, reiterating that America will not serve as a safe haven for criminal aliens.
